Sei (“I know”) is the seventh album by Brazilian band Nando Reis e os Infernais. It was recorded in Seattle, Washington, with the help of producer Jack Endino, who had already produced four studio albums for Titãs, Nando Reis’ ex-band.[1] According to Nando, Endino is the “right guy” to record Os Infernais’ sound.[2]

It was nominated for the Latin Grammy Awards of 2013 in the Best Brazilian Rock Album category.[3]

Sei is Reis’ first independent album, after Universal Music Group refused to renew the deal they had with Reis.[4] According to him, the process of going indie is irreversible.[4] Also, he stated:[4]

“Universal didn’t want to renew our contract, and I wanted to have this experience. It doesn’t make much difference in terms of art, the changes are more visible at the management side, in the conception of the selling of the album. It’s something that I could only do this way if I was alone.”

Reis also stated he didn’t understand the mechanics of the recording companies, “such as the profit margin, with albums being sold for R$30,00 (US$15,00) and almost a year later they cost R$5,00.”[5]
